Altabancorp (Nasdaq:ALTA)

Under the terms of the agreement, Altabancorp shareholders will receive only 0.7971 shares of Glacier stock for each Altabancorp share. Based on the closing price of $61.51 for Glacier shares on May 17, 2021, the transaction implies a per share consideration of $49.02 per Altabancorp share. The investigation concerns whether the Altabancorp Board breached its fiduciary duties to shareholders by failing to conduct a fair process and whether Glacier is paying too little for the Company.

Atotech Limited (NYSE:ATC)

Under the terms of the merger agreement, Atotech shareholders will receive only $16.20 in cash and 0.0552 of MKS common stock for each share of Atotech they own. The investigation concerns whether the Atotech Board breached its fiduciary duties to Atotech shareholders and whether MKS is paying too little for the Company. For example, the implied deal consideration is below the recent 52-week high of $26.67 for the Company's shares.

County Bancorp, Inc. (Nasdaq:ICBK)

Under the terms of the merger agreement, County shareholders have the right to receive for each share of County common stock, at the election of each holder and subject to proration, either cash of $37.18 per share of County common stock or 0.48 shares of Nicolet common stock. County shareholder elections will be prorated to ensure the total consideration will consist of approximately 20% cash and approximately 80% Nicolet common stock. The investigation concerns whether the County Board breached its fiduciary duties to shareholders by failing to conduct a fair process and whether Nicolet is paying too little for the Company.
